Lists of cities and towns list notable cities and towns in each country, and are organized by geographic area. See Lists of cities and Lists of towns for additional lists organized in different ways, such as by size.,

The International Council of Museums defines a museum as "a not-for-profit, permanent institution in the service of society that researches, collects, conserves, interprets and exhibits tangible and intangible heritage. Open to the public, accessible and inclusive, museums foster diversity and sustainability. They operate and communicate ethically, professionally and with the participation of communities, offering varied experiences for education, enjoyment, reflection and knowledge sharing.”
